The Bachelorette alum Blake Moynes and Love Is Blind Season 2 alum Natalie Lee have sparked dating speculation after a Caribbean trip.

"The crossover nobody asked for," Natalie teased Sunday on her Instagram Stories alongside a video featuring Blake, according to Us Weekly.

Blake, who competed on The Bachelorette's sixteenth and seventeenth seasons, also shared a glimpse into his "breakfast date" with Natalie on Monday morning.

Blake and Natalie laughed as they dined together, and Natalie later gushed about her "amazing" dinner with the wildlife manager at the Four Seasons Resort in Nevis.

Natalie later joked about Blake on her Instagram account, showing she has a sense of humor and they have a playful dynamic.

Natalie uploaded an image of the former reality TV stars sitting in silence next to each other, and she wrote on Monday, "My favorite part of this trip was the meaningful conversations we had during our breaks, as seen here."

While the pair sparked rumors of a possible romance, Blake and Natalie were in the West Indies on business -- to work with the Sea Turtle Conservatory.

"Natalie took an interest in Blake's philanthropic work quite quickly, they've been having a lot of fun while helping the turtle conservancy achieve their mission this past week," a source told Us.

Blake and Natalie were reportedly introduced by their mutual representative.

"Natalie doesn't take herself too seriously while Blake definitely does, especially when it comes to his work... They're having a blast," the source said, adding that they made a "perfect" pair on the trip and shared "lots of laughs."

The source explained how Blake has been bringing "various celebrities" on these trips to help him projects that are "very dear to his heart" and to raise awareness for animal conservation.

"He's trying to take advantage of the platform he's been given to make a difference for endangered species and doing whatever he can to help," the source told the magazine.

Blake explained Monday on his Instagram Stories how the work he's been doing with Natalie is "crucial for sea turtles" and their protection.

Both Blake and Natalie, who are currently single, have been engaged once before.

Natalie nearly married Shayne Jansen on Season 2 of Love Is Blind. While they reunited after filming ended, they announced their breakup soon afterwards.

And Blake proposed marriage to Katie Thurston during her The Bachelorette finale, which aired in August 2021.

Blake and Katie, however, realized they weren't compatible once they dated in the real world, and so they announced their breakup in late October, shortly before Katie went Instagram official with one of her The Bachelorette Week 2 eliminees, San Diego-based bartender John Hersey, in November.

Katie faced backlash for having moved on from her former fiance too quickly with a "rebound," and Blake said on the "Talking It Out with Bachelor Nation" podcast in November that he felt "flabbergasted," shocked and "speechless" upon finding out about Katie's romance with John.

Blake also said he believed Katie had been emotionally cheating on him with John -- which Katie and John have both firmly denied in the press.

Katie admitted she and John considered hiding their relationship at first in fear of how Bachelor Nation might react to them.

"We were already talking about how to not be [seen and] known. But it's also like, 'F-ck that.' I want to live our best life. I want to live in my happiness. I went through hell and back being on TV," Katie said in April.

Katie said she had determined that she owed it to herself to be in her "truest" and "happiest form."

"At the end of the day, I was like, 'Life is too short. I've gone through so much and I just want to be happy.' And so that's ultimately what we did; we owned our connection not knowing it would take us to this day," Katie told Kaitlyn Bristowe on her "Off the Vine" podcast.

Katie and John appeared to be madly in love and moved in together in early 2022, but they announced their split in June.

For Blake's part, he told Ben Higgins and Ashley Iaconetti on their "The Ben & Ashley I: Almost Famous Podcast" in February that he was ready to put his romance with Katie behind him and put aside any hard feelings.

Blake also recently suggested he'd be open to dating both women from Bachelor Nation or someone without fame and a social-media following.
